Understanding Kybella: The Science Behind the Treatment
Kybella is an FDA-approved injectable that uses a synthetic form of deoxycholic acid, a substance naturally found in the body, to break down and absorb fat cells. Once injected into the submental fat (the area beneath the chin), the acid works by destroying the fat cells, permanently reducing the appearance of a double chin. The procedure is relatively quick and minimally invasive, often requiring multiple sessions to achieve the desired result.
